SOA Work Group

Objective of Meeting

The SOA Work Group exists to develop and foster common understanding of SOA in order to facilitate alignment between the business and IT communities. The purpose of this meeting was to progress its work on a new version of its SOA Reference Architecture, and to discuss the formation of a new project to create a certification program for SOA professionals.

Summary

The meeting reviewed a draft charter for the proposed certification project, and a draft of the new version of the SOA Reference Architecture.

Outputs

The meeting produced updated drafts of the certification project charter and the SOA Reference Architecture.

Next Steps

The SOA Work Group will vote on the draft certification project charter and, if it is approved, the project will start.

Work will continue on the SOA Reference Architecture. The Open Group is liaising with ISO/IEC JTC1 SC38 (DAPS) and with IEEE Project P1723, both of which bodies are developing SOA reference architectures. The results of the meeting will be input to those bodies, as well as being the basis for further work within The Open Group.
